Potassium humate is the potassium salt of humic acid. It is manufactured commercially by alkaline extraction of brown coal leonardite and is used mainly as a soil conditioner.
Potassium humate is used in agriculture as a fertilizer additive to increase the efficiency of fertilizers especially nitrogen- and phosphorus-based fertilizer inputs.
The key difference between potassium humate and humic acid is that potassium humate is the potassium salt of humic acid, whereas humic acid is an important organic acid that occurs as a component in soil. Humic acid and potassium humate are generally very important components in fertile soil.
The exogenous application of potassium humate can improve soil properties and increase their fertility through increasing the amounts of potassium (K) in the soil, which boosts plant performance. K is a crucial element that could increase plant dry matter and enhance productivity
